Understanding the Certification Process

For those passionate about hunting in Texas, obtaining a Hunter Education Certification is mandatory for hunters born on or after September 2, 1971. This certification not only assures compliance with Texas law but also endorses safe and responsible hunting practices.

Why Certification Matters

  • Legal Requirement: The certification is a prerequisite for purchasing a hunting license in Texas.
  • Safety Assurance: It ensures hunters are informed about safety measures, ethical practices, and wildlife conservation.
  • Skill Enhancement: The course material equips hunters with enhanced knowledge of hunting techniques and responsibilities.

Topics Covered

Expect questions on the following topics:

  1. Hunter Ethics and Responsibilities
  2. Wildlife Conservation Principles
  3. Firearm Safety and Handling
  4. First Aid and Survival Skills
  5. Regulations and Laws
  6. Hunting Techniques
